Introduction to Electric Garage Heaters 120V

Electric garage heaters 120V are a type of heating solution designed specifically for garages and other outdoor or indoor workspaces. These heaters are electrically powered and operate on a standard 120-volt household current. They are a popular choice among homeowners and professionals due to their ease of installation, energy efficiency, and cost-effectiveness.

One of the primary benefits of electric garage heaters 120V is their ability to provide a reliable and consistent source of heat. Unlike propane or gas-powered heaters, electric heaters do not produce any fumes or emissions, making them a safer choice for enclosed spaces. Additionally, they are generally quieter and require less maintenance than their gas-powered counterparts.

When selecting an electric garage heater, there are several factors to consider. These include the heater’s power output, coverage area, and durability. It is essential to choose a heater that is suitable for the size of your garage and can provide adequate heat to keep the space comfortable. Some electric garage heaters 120V also come with additional features such as thermostats, timers, and remote controls, which can enhance their functionality and convenience.

Heating Type and Technology

Electric garage heaters come in different types, including convection, radiant, and infrared heaters. Each type has its unique characteristics and advantages. Convection heaters are the most common type and work by circulating warm air throughout the garage. Radiant heaters, on the other hand, emit infrared radiation to warm up objects and people. Infrared heaters are energy-efficient and can provide rapid heating.

The heating technology used in electric garage heaters is also an important consideration. Look for heaters with advanced features such as thermostat control, timer, and remote control. These features can help you optimize the heater’s performance and energy efficiency. Some heaters also come with safety features such as overheat protection, tip-over switch, and cool-touch exterior. Safety Features and Certifications

Safety should be a top priority when it comes to electric garage heaters. Look for heaters that have undergone rigorous testing and certification by reputable organizations such as UL (Underwriters Laboratories) or ETL (Intertek). These certifications ensure that the heater meets strict safety standards and can operate safely in your garage. Additionally, consider heaters with built-in safety features such as overheat protection, thermal cut-off, and ground fault protection.

When evaluating the safety features of an electric garage heater, also consider the material and construction of the unit. A well-built heater with a durable and fire-resistant enclosure can provide added peace of mind. Some heaters also come with features such as a tip-over switch, which automatically shuts off the heater if it is tipped or knocked over. By choosing a heater with robust safety features and certifications, you can minimize the risk of accidents and ensure a safe and comfortable garage environment.

How do I choose the right size electric garage heater for my space?

Choosing the right size electric garage heater for your space is crucial to ensure that it provides enough heat to keep your garage warm and comfortable. To determine the right size, you’ll need to consider the size of your garage, as well as the level of insulation and the desired temperature. A general rule of thumb is to choose a heater that can produce between 10-20 BTUs per square foot of garage space. For example, a small one-car garage may require a heater with a output of around 5,000-10,000 BTUs, while a larger garage may require a heater with a output of 20,000-30,000 BTUs or more.

It’s also important to consider the type of heating you need, such as spot heating or whole-garage heating. Spot heating is useful for warming up a specific area, such as a workbench or storage area, while whole-garage heating is better for warming up the entire space. Are electric garage heaters safe to use?

Electric garage heaters are generally safe to use, as long as you follow the manufacturer’s instructions and take some basic precautions. One of the biggest safety concerns with electric garage heaters is the risk of fire, which can occur if the heater is not properly installed or maintained. To minimize this risk, make sure to choose a heater that has been certified by a reputable testing organization, such as UL or ETL. You should also keep the heater at least 3-4 feet away from any flammable materials, such as gasoline, paint, or sawdust.

Additionally, make s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for installation, maintenance, and use. This includes checking the heater’s cord and plug for damage, keeping the heater clean and free of dust, and avoiding overload by not using too many extension cords or plugs. It’s also a good idea to install a GFCI outlet in your garage, which can help protect against electrical shock.
